A Journey Through Negril’s Hidden Gems
As a former professional surfer, I’ve always been drawn to the ocean’s call, and my recent adventure in Negril, Jamaica, was no exception. The One Love Bus Bar Crawl promised an authentic Jamaican experience, and I was eager to dive into the local culture. The day began with a sense of anticipation as I joined a group of fellow explorers at Couples Swept Away. Lenbert, our charismatic guide, greeted us with a warm smile and a promise of an unforgettable journey.
The bus was packed with a lively mix of travelers from the US, Canada, France, and the UK, all eager to explore Negril’s local bars. Our first stop was the No Name Bar, a charming spot just a short drive away. As I sipped on a cold Red Stripe, I watched a local perform a daring cliff jump, a reminder of the thrill-seeking spirit that resonates with my own love for surfing. The atmosphere was electric, with reggae tunes filling the air and the camaraderie of new friends sharing stories and laughter.
Discovering Negril’s Local Flavors
The tour took us to a variety of bars, each with its own unique charm. Some were familiar, while others were hidden gems waiting to be discovered. One memorable stop was at a bar run by a local artist and her husband. Her vibrant crafts and paintings adorned the walls, offering a glimpse into the creative soul of Jamaica. It was a reminder of the island’s rich culture and the importance of supporting local artisans.
As we continued our journey, Lenbert introduced us to Shanty Town, a humbling experience that highlighted the resilience and warmth of the Jamaican people. The opportunity to give back to the community was a touching moment, as travelers donated school supplies and essentials to the local children. It was a reminder that travel is not just about exploration but also about connection and compassion.
